Silicon Valley is buzzing with an exciting new productivity paradigm known as 'Tokenmaxxing,' which encourages engineers to fully leverage Generative AI in their daily workflows. By maximizing the number of tokens processed through AI models, professionals can delegate routine coding and design tasks to their AI assistants, unlocking unprecedented levels of efficiency. This innovative mindset shift empowers developers to focus on higher-level problem-solving and dramatically accelerate software development.

View Original"Tokenmaxxing is a concept aimed at making work possible that would normally be impossible, by using as many 'tokens' (the units of words or chunks of text processed by AI) as possible in conversations and prompts with AI models, bringing the way we work closer to an image of simply giving instructions to AI."
